Market overview

Homes in this market average about 31 years old and around 2,075 square feet, which affects prep, layout complexity, and total material usage. About 86.5% of homes are single-family and the area sees roughly 208 rain days per year, which affects jobsite conditions, moisture control, and installation planning. Labor costs reflect a local index of about 0.856 and material pricing is impacted by a sales tax rate near 8.25%. A typical whole-home flooring project in Sugar Land is often around 2,075 square feet, with labor commonly landing between $3,299 and $4,046 before material, removal, trim, and floor prep.

Product recommendations for this market

  • In Sugar Land, humidity can reach about 78%, so luxury vinyl plank is often used to reduce expansion risk and simplify acclimation compared to laminate or solid hardwood.
  • Laminate flooring in Sugar Land can be more sensitive to moisture at these humidity levels, so it usually requires tighter acclimation timing and better jobsite moisture control to avoid swelling or edge lift.
  • With homes averaging about 31 years old, engineered hardwood is often chosen over solid hardwood because it handles minor subfloor variation and seasonal movement more predictably.

Texas does not require a state-level contractor license for flooring installation work. The city requires flooring contractor registration. The department, office, portal, or system that handles this registration is department not specified.
Labor separately stated is not taxable. Flooring materials sold are taxable.
Local delivery is taxable.

Most flooring projects in Sugar Land take about 1 to 3 days for a few rooms, while whole-home projects, removal, floor prep, stairs, or trim work can extend the schedule. Material choice, subfloor condition, furniture moving, and acclimation time also affect the timeline.
For resale in Sugar Land, the best flooring is usually the option that balances appearance, durability, and broad buyer appeal. Engineered hardwood is often a strong upgrade choice, while luxury vinyl plank works well when you want a more budget-friendly floor that still looks clean and modern.
